Key Planning Factors
Guest permit requirements represent the most critical planning factor couples consistently underestimate. Lakshadweep administration requires individual permits for every mainland visitor, processed through a bureaucratic system that can take 45-60 days during peak wedding season. Smart couples submit permit applications immediately after venue booking to avoid last-minute rejections.
Transportation logistics demand military-precision coordination since Agatti Airport serves as the only entry point, followed by helicopter transfers to Minicoy. A Delhi-based wedding party discovered this complexity when their December celebration required three separate helicopter trips at ₹18,000 per person due to weight restrictions during peak tourist season.
Vendor availability fluctuates dramatically based on seasonal demand and inter-island transportation schedules. Professional photographers and decorators often book Lakshadweep assignments in clusters, meaning couples must align with predetermined vendor travel windows or pay premium rates for exclusive trips. The smartest approach involves coordinating with experienced destination wedding vendors who understand island logistics.
Weather contingency planning extends beyond simple rain backup since storms can ground flights for 2-3 days. Successful couples build 48-hour buffer periods before and after their wedding dates, ensuring guests aren't stranded and vendors have flexibility for setup delays.

Ceremony & Reception Options
Minicoy Beach Resort offers three distinct celebration spaces that cater to different wedding styles and guest counts. The oceanfront lawn accommodates 80-100 guests for ceremonies with unobstructed sunset views, while the beachside pavilion works perfectly for intimate 40-60 person celebrations with natural wind protection during evening receptions.
Timing decisions significantly impact both cost and experience quality. Morning ceremonies (7-9 AM) provide the most comfortable temperatures and stunning lighting but require careful breakfast coordination since most guests prefer traditional lunch receptions. Evening ceremonies (4-6 PM) offer magical sunset backdrops but face potential wind challenges that can disrupt décor and sound systems.
Décor possibilities range from minimal tropical elegance to elaborate beachfront wedding installations that rival mainland luxury venues. However, salt air and sand present unique challenges for flower arrangements and fabric elements. Experienced island decorators recommend specific materials and setup techniques that withstand coastal conditions while maintaining visual impact throughout multi-hour celebrations.
Reception flow planning requires different thinking than traditional indoor venues. Open-air dining means backup plans for sudden weather changes, while natural acoustics affect music and speech timing. Successful destination celebrations integrate these environmental factors into the experience rather than fighting against them.

Budget Planning Guide
Tropical oceanfront weddings at Minicoy typically cost 40-60% more than equivalent mainland celebrations due to transportation logistics and vendor premiums. However, the intimate guest count naturally reduces several major expense categories like catering volume, invitation printing, and accommodation blocks compared to traditional 300-500 person Indian weddings.
Transportation represents the largest hidden cost that couples consistently underestimate. Beyond guest flights and helicopter transfers, vendors charge premium rates for equipment transport and extended island stays. A Chennai couple discovered their photographer's final bill included ₹85,000 in travel costs that weren't clearly outlined in initial quotations, highlighting the importance of comprehensive vendor agreements.
Food and beverage planning requires special consideration since alcohol permits and specialty ingredients must be arranged months in advance. The resort's catering team handles permit logistics, but couples pay significant markups on imported items. Smart budget planning focuses on locally available ingredients and traditional preparations that reduce import dependencies and costs.
Hidden savings opportunities exist for couples who understand island economics.
